Get to know the next batch of Battlefield Judges

Today, we are excited to introduce the fourth wave of judges participating in the competition. Only another revelation remains. Stay tuned to Disrupt the agenda To see who will be the last five judges.

Allison Baum Gates, General Partner, Sempervirens Venture Capital

Allison Baum Gates He is a general associate in UnfinishedA business funds fund investing in healthcare, Fintech and Enterprise Saas. To date, it has raised hundreds of millions of dollars from LPS in the US, Europe and Asia and has developed funds in more than 70 companies, including nine unicorns and 24 outputs and holds 10 seats by the Board of Directors.

Gates has been presented in major publications such as the Financial Times, the Wall Street Journal, Forbes and Techcrunch and have taught hundreds of business school students. He is a lecturer in the administration at Stanford GSB and the author of “Breaking in Venture” (McGraw-Hill, 2023), a comprehensive driver for navigation in the VC industry. Her second book, “Beyond The Pitch: The Psychology of increasing VC funding”, will be released next year. He holds a ba in economics with prices from Harvard University and is capable of three languages.

Katelin Holloway, Founding Partner, Sevensvensix

Katelin Holloway He is a founding associate of Alexis Ohanian’s business capital company, Sevensevensix. An experienced investor with more than 20 years of business experience in companies such as Pixar and Reddit, Holloway Backs Transforming Standards in various fields. It invests in solutions that extend human resources and durability, health promotion, exploring new borders, promoting viability, promoting creativity and enriching human experience.

At Sevenssevensix, Holloway combines its operational experience with a deep commitment to support the founders as they challenge early stage challenges and escalate their visions. It is dedicated to the reform of business capital by strengthening generations of businessmen to tackle the greatest challenges of mankind, while providing excellent returns.

Miloni Madan Presler, Partner, Institutional Partners of Business Conferences (IVP)

Miloni Madan Prossler It is passionate about working with businesses that innovate with purpose – companies that solve real problems and not innovate for the sake of innovation. As a general associate in Institutional Business Partners (IVP)It focuses on supporting the founders who build products and solutions that people really need, not only want. It seeks companies that bridge gaps in fragmented ecosystems, automate outdated processes and provide platforms based on data capable of transforming industries. Madan is guided by the belief that these companies – and their impact – will endure far beyond any investment, and this pursuit of constant change feeds its commitment and feasibility to every partnership.

Sara Ittelson, Associate, Accel

Sara ittelson He joined the Accel in 2022 and focuses on consumer, business and AI early stadium companies. Before AccelerateHe was head of strategic partnerships in Faire and previously worked on world business development in Uber. Ittelson is from Chico, California and graduated from Northwestern University and Stanford.

Rinki Sethi, Founding Partner, Lockstep

Rinki sethi He is head of security officer in Upward security and founding partner at Lock. He has previously worked as Vice President and Head of Information Security Officer on Twitter, Bill and Rubrik and held superior security leadership roles in Palo Alto, IBM, Ebay and Intuit. Sethi brings deep know -how to both the private sector and the corporate councils, shaping the security strategy at higher levels.
